Don’t smoke in a home when you have kids. Secondhand smoke is just as damaging as actually smoking. Children who are exposed to second-hand smoke on a regular basis are at greater risk for developing respiratory illnesses, asthma and even pneumonia.

Try to establish and adhere to a routine each night when you are preparing your child for bed.A regular bedtime routine will get your kid in the mindset from playtime to bedtime. When the pajamas go on, putting on pajamas and hearing a story in bed, then he acclimates to the idea that sleep is the next step in the bedtime ritual. Your child is less likely to rebel against going to bed if he expects it as part of his nightly routine.
